Appropriate Trimming Cuts for Tree Health And Wellness



When it comes to maintaining the health of your trees, making proper pruning cuts is vital. Inaccurate cuts can bring about disease, insect invasion, and total tree decline. To ensure the vigor of your trees, always begin by using sharp, clean devices to make accurate cuts.

Begin by identifying the branch collar, a puffy area where the branch affixes to the trunk. Cutting simply outside the collar aids promote proper healing and reduces the risk of infection. Avoid leaving stubs as they can invite insects and conditions right into the tree.

Timing and Frequency of Trimming



To keep the health and structure of your trees, comprehending the optimal timing and regularity of trimming is vital.

The best time to trim trees is generally during the dormant period in late winter or very early springtime. Trimming throughout this period aids promote new development once the tree starts budding in the spring.

Nonetheless, some trees, like spring-flowering ones, are best pruned right after they complete flowering to prevent cutting off next year's flower buds.

Routine pruning is necessary, yet the frequency depends upon the tree types and its growth rate. For most trees, an annual assessment to eliminate dead, unhealthy, or crossing branches is recommended. Youthful trees may call for more constant trimming to develop a strong structure, while mature trees may only need maintenance trimming every few years.

Prevent trimming throughout the autumn when diseases are extra easily spread out, and avoid heavy trimming during the summer season when the tree is proactively growing.

Educating Young Trees for Framework



For developing strong and healthy trees, training young trees for optimal framework is necessary. By shaping a tree when it's young, you set the foundation for a tough and aesthetically appealing mature tree.



Begin by determining the main leader, which is the primary upward-growing branch. Urge the central leader's growth by pruning away completing leaders, helping the tree develop a solid central trunk. Furthermore, eliminate any type of branches that grow inward or downward, as they can cause structural problems as the tree expands.

It is necessary to room out lateral branches equally around the trunk to promote balanced development. As the tree grows, remain to check its growth and trim as needed to preserve its shape and framework.

Appropriately trained young trees are less most likely to develop weak crotches or chock-full branches, lowering the threat of damage during tornados. Investing time in training young trees will pay off with a magnificently structured and resilient tree in the future.
